I do not get it. This does super little for me as far as atmosphere goes. There’s some good riffage, and I honestly don’t mind any of the ā€œrepetitivenessā€, but by golly I just think it is bad. The vocals genuinely sound like a meme of bad black metal vocals to me. Like, those videos where a guy goes up to people in the line for metal shows and asks for people to do their best scream. And it definitely doesn’t get the ā€œso raw it adds to the atmosphereā€ with respect to production. It just sounds not good. I compare them to a contemporary, Emperor (who I’m not really ā€œintoā€, but I definitely get it more), who I think actually can actually capture the raw, cold, and evil vibe of BM. Someone make me understand this record (or the two other big Darkthrone records surrounding it).
